AMGN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

2,852 of the 7,596 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Amgen (AMGN)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$121B — down 9.7% from $133B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 182 funds closed out of AMGN and 145 opened new positions — a net loss of 37 holders — while 1,096 trimmed existing stakes and 1,230 added.

The largest buyer was Capital International Investors, adding an estimated $1.07B. The largest seller was Primecap Management, cutting an estimated $498M.
